A five-night Koufonisia honeymoon itinerary
This itinerary is designed for couples who want the island at its most relaxed. It pairs easy exploration with slow, luxurious hours back at your suite.
Day 1: Arrive, exhale, and enjoy Chora
Ferries generally arrive close to Chora, the main village of Ano Koufonisi. After checking in, resist the temptation to fit everything into the first afternoon. Change into swimwear, settle onto your terrace, and let the Aegean view do the work.
Chora is ideal for a first evening because its whitewashed lanes, cafés, and restaurants are all within an easy walk. Wander without a destination before choosing a table for dinner. Order simply and well – local fish when available, Greek salads, grilled vegetables, and a bottle of something cold – then take the scenic route back through the village.
A central suite suits couples who value stepping out for dinner, browsing small shops, and returning home on foot. If your priority is a quiet evening in, pick up a few local ingredients and enjoy your private kitchen and outdoor dining area instead.
Day 2: Pori Beach and a sunset made for two
Start early enough to experience Pori before the beach reaches its liveliest point. Its broad curve of pale sand and exceptionally clear water has made it one of Koufonisia’s signature landscapes. Bring water, sun protection, and a light cover-up for the walk or ride back, as the midday sun can feel intense.
For honeymooners, the real luxury of Pori is not checking it off a list. Swim slowly, read in the shade, and stay long enough for the colors of the water to change with the afternoon light. Couples staying above Pori have the added pleasure of returning to a more private setting, where panoramic views and a pool or jacuzzi extend the beach day rather than ending it.
As evening approaches, keep plans deliberately simple. A sunset aperitif on your terrace can be more romantic than another reservation. Day 3: The coastal path, hidden coves, and an unhurried dinner
The coastal walk east of Chora is one of the island’s essential experiences. It passes a sequence of small beaches and swimming spots, including Finikas, Fanos, and Pori, with luminous water inviting you to stop often. Begin in the morning, when the route feels quieter and the light is soft across the sea.
Do not treat the walk as a hike to complete. Wear comfortable sandals or walking shoes, pack a towel, and select one or two coves rather than trying to swim everywhere. Fanos is a lovely choice for couples who want clear water and a casual beach atmosphere, while quieter stretches along the path can offer a more intimate pause.
Return to your suite in the late afternoon for a shower, a nap, or time in the pool. This is one of the reasons the best Koufonisia honeymoon itineraries should never be overplanned: the island is at its finest when beach time and suite time are given equal value.
For dinner, reserve a table in Chora or follow the evening mood. A late meal after sunset lets you enjoy the village as it grows softer and more animated, without feeling rushed.
Day 4: A boat day to Kato Koufonisi
A day trip by boat to Kato Koufonisi adds a beautiful sense of escape to a honeymoon stay. The smaller, largely uninhabited island is known for wild coves, bright water, and the feeling that the Cyclades are still wonderfully elemental. Boat schedules and conditions vary, so confirm the details locally and stay flexible.
Bring what you need for the day: water, snacks, reef-safe sun protection, a hat, and cash for any simple tavern stop. The appeal here is not polished beach service. It is the pleasure of swimming in water so clear that the sea floor seems close enough to touch.
After a sun-filled day, plan nothing formal for the evening. Order in or prepare an easy dinner at your accommodation. A honeymoon should include at least one night when the best table is the one outside your own suite, with the sound of the island settling around you.
Day 5: Choose your own pace
Your final full day should be shaped by what you have loved most. Return to Pori for another long swim, revisit a favorite Chora restaurant, or reserve the morning for complete privacy. Couples often underestimate how restorative it is to spend several hours with no plans beyond coffee, a dip in the pool, and a book.
If you want a little movement, an e-bike or small vehicle can make it easy to revisit beaches without walking in the hottest part of the day. If you prefer to keep the day close to home, make the most of the details that elevate a premium stay: a cool interior, a thoughtfully designed outdoor space, a jacuzzi at golden hour, or a quiet lunch prepared in your kitchen.
Save your final sunset for somewhere meaningful. It might be from a waterfront table in Chora, a private terrace above Pori, or a familiar stretch of beach that now feels like yours.
How to choose between Chora and Pori for a honeymoon
The right location depends on the kind of privacy you mean. Chora offers social ease: restaurants, bakeries, the harbor, and evening strolls are close by. It is a natural choice for couples who like to head out spontaneously and enjoy the gentle energy of village life.
Pori feels more removed and immersive. The beach, open sea, and larger outdoor spaces create a more secluded mood, especially for couples planning slow mornings and private sunset hours. It can be particularly appealing for a special-occasion stay where the accommodation itself is part of the itinerary.
There is no wrong choice. Couples who enjoy dining out every night may prefer Chora, while those who picture long terrace lunches and more time by a private pool may find Pori irresistible. Consider splitting your stay only if you have at least six nights; otherwise, changing accommodations can interrupt the ease you came for.
Small details that make the itinerary feel effortless
Koufonisia is wonderfully compact, but it is still worth planning around the practicalities. Ferry arrival times can shift, the strongest sun is usually between late morning and midafternoon, and popular tables can fill during the busiest summer weeks. Arrange transportation support in advance if you want an e-bike or vehicle, especially in high season.
Pack lightly but thoughtfully. A good beach bag, sandals that handle uneven paths, a linen layer for breezy evenings, and one outfit that feels special for dinner will take you far. Leave room in your schedule for weather changes, a favorite beach you want to revisit, and the rare pleasure of deciding that you would rather stay beside the water a little longer.
